On any bass - acoustic or electric - the scale length is the distance from the nut at the top of the fretboard to the bridge or bridge saddle. The "A" string is usually used to make the measurement. I can't speak for acoustic bass, but bass Guitars commonly come in two scale elngths: "short" (30", some manufacturers use 31") and "long" (34"),

Why did gaspar invent the double bass?

The double bass was not invented by a single individual named Gaspar; rather, it evolved over time from earlier string instruments. The development of the double bass in the 17th century was influenced by the need for a deeper, resonant bass sound in orchestras and ensembles. Instrument makers sought to create a larger string instrument that could provide the harmonic foundation for music, leading to the design of the double bass as we know it today.

Why does a violin sound higher than a double bass?

Pitch is determined by the size of the instrument and the length of the string. Because the body of the violin is smaller, the strings are also shorter, allowing it to produce pitches far higher than those of the double bass.
